Overview

The Minerallac Company 59032 is a 1/4" diameter by 2" length Zamac Hammer Drive Nailin Anchor. Designed for light-duty fastening in concrete, solid brick, or block materials, this anchor provides a mechanical fastening solution for low-load installations. The Zamac alloy construction ensures corrosion resistance, making it suitable for indoor or protected outdoor environments. Installation is straightforward via hammer drive, ideal for securing lightweight fixtures, electrical boxes, or trim where minimal holding strength is required.

Frequently Asked Questions about Minerallac Company

What are the main product lines offered by Minerallac Company?

Minerallac Company offers multiple comprehensive product lines including Minerallac Traditional (electrical fasteners), Strut Fittings, Stainless Steel Fasteners, Black Claw, Impact Staples, and Redmore. Their Traditional line features over a thousand electrical fastener variations covering conduit/cable/wire products, nail straps, beam clamps, metal stud & drywall accessories, acoustical supports, voice/data hardware, and miscellaneous electrical installation components.

What is Minerallac Company's warranty policy?

Minerallac Company provides a limited warranty that guarantees all products are free from defects in material and workmanship. If a product fails to meet this warranty, Minerallac's sole liability is to replace the product at no charge. The warranty is exclusive and does not cover consequential damages, lost profits, or implied warranties of merchantability or fitness for a particular purpose.
